Shell guides to lower oil production in second quarter

  • Shell PLC (LSEHEL, NYSEHEL) expects oil production to fall in the second quarter due to scheduled maintenance and the sale of its onshore oil and gas joint venture in Nigeria.  Ahead of its second quarter results on July 31, the FTSE 100 oil giant said upstream production is likely to drop to between 1.66 million and 1.76 million barrels of oil equivalent per day, down from 1.86 million in the first quarter.
